Yamid,

Is there any thing listed with the error, such as Bus# Device# and Function #?
Also, when you removed the expansion cards, did you also remove or reseat the Raid Controller as well?

Lastly, try taking the server to a Minimum to Post configuration. Remove everything from inside the server but the following,

  • System board
  • Processor (with heatsink) in socket 1
  • One stick of memory in slot 1
  • 1 power supply
  • Power distribution board
  • Control panel (to turn on system) 

Then power up to see if it clears POST.

Let me know what you find in regards to the complete error.
